Simple Hummus

This is a simple, delicious recipe for making your own hummus at home. Hummus is great for adding to your favorite meal or for snacking with!
PREP TIME
10 minutes
COOK TIME
0 minutes
TOTAL TIME
10 minutes
COURSE
Snack
CUISINE
Middle Eastern
SERVINGS
16
EQUIPMENT
  • Food Strainer
  • Measuring Cups
  • Measuring Spoons
  • Food Processor
  • Spatula
INGREDIENTS
  • 1 (15 ounce) can chickpeas, rinsed and drained
  • ⅓ cup smooth tahini
  • 2 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il
  • 2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ice, more to taste
  • 1-2 medium cloves garlic, peeled and smashed
  • ½ teaspoon sea salt
  • 5 tablespoons water, or as needed to blend
  • paprika, red pepper flakes, or parsley, for garnish
  • (optional) warm pita bread and/or veggies, for serving
INSTRUCTIONS
  1. Add tahini, 2-3 tablespoon cold water, olive oil, cumin, salt, garlic, and lemon juice to a food processor. Puree until smooth.
  2. Add in the chickpeas. Puree for 3-4 minutes, pausing halfway to scrape down the sides of the bowl, until the hummus is smooth. If it seems too thick, add in another tablespoon or two of water.
  3. Transfer to a serving plate, top with desired garnishes and serve with warm pita and veggies, as desired.
NOTES

Profile Exchange: 1 fat
